Tangipahoa Parish school board renews portable leases, adopts 2026–27 calendar and directs study of 2027–28 balanced calendar

Tangipahoa Parish School Board · November 19, 2025

At its Nov. 18 meeting the Tangipahoa Parish School Board approved lease renewals for portable classrooms (subject to court approval), adopted the administration’s recommended 2026–27 calendar and voted to study — but not adopt — a balanced calendar for 2027–28.

The Tangipahoa Parish School Board on Nov. 18 approved several routine and facility-related actions, including renewal of portable-classroom leases, adoption of the 2026–27 academic calendar and a directive to administration to study a balanced calendar for 2027–28 rather than adopt it now.
